Commonly asked questions

What questions should I ask when viewing a house for rent in Whatawhata?

When viewing a house for rent in Whatawhata, ask about lease terms, included utilities, maintenance responsibilities, pet policies, neighborhood safety, and how rent payments are handled. Use Rentola to view full details for each listing.

If I rent a house in Whatawhata, who is responsible for repairs?

Landlords are generally responsible for structural repairs and essential systems in rental houses in Whatawhata. Tenants may be responsible for minor maintenance. Clarify this in your lease.

When renting a house in Whatawhata, am I responsible for general maintenance?

Yes, in many cases, tenants in Whatawhata are responsible for minor upkeep like changing light bulbs or keeping the property clean. Major repairs are typically covered by the landlord.

Do I need to pay for electricity when renting a house in Whatawhata?

In most cases, yes. Tenants in Whatawhata are usually responsible for utility payments such as electricity, water, and internet. Always verify this in the listing or rental agreement.
